What Does “Flash Android Phone” Mean?

Flashing an Android phone means reinstalling the phone’s system software (firmware) from scratch. This process removes the existing operating system, including screen lock data, and installs a fresh system.

In simple words:

  • Flashing = reinstall Android software
  • Pattern/PIN lock = stored inside system data
  • Flashing deletes the lock along with user data

Flashing is different from a normal factory reset because it uses a computer and flash tool to rewrite the phone’s firmware.

Flashing Android Phone Using Stock Firmware (Most Reliable Method)

What Is Stock Firmware?

Stock firmware is the original software provided by the phone manufacturer. Flashing stock firmware resets the phone to factory condition.

Why Stock Firmware Is Best for Beginners

  • Official and safe
  • Stable performance
  • No malware risk
  • Compatible with device hardware

Steps to Flash Android Phone Using Stock Firmware

  1. Identify your phone model number
  2. Download correct firmware for the model
  3. Install USB drivers on PC
  4. Install the required flash tool
  5. Boot phone into download or fastboot mode
  6. Connect phone to PC
  7. Load firmware files in flash tool
  8. Start flashing process
  9. Wait until flashing completes
  10. Reboot phone

After reboot, the pattern or PIN lock is removed.

How to Flash Samsung Phone After Forgot Pattern or PIN Lock

Samsung phones use a specific flashing method.

Tools Required for Samsung Flashing

  • Odin flash tool
  • Samsung USB drivers
  • Samsung stock firmware

Samsung Flashing Steps (Beginner-Friendly)

  1. Power off Samsung phone
  2. Press Volume Down + Power + Home (or Bixby)
  3. Enter Download Mode
  4. Open Odin on PC
  5. Load firmware files (AP, BL, CP, CSC)
  6. Click Start
  7. Wait for PASS message
  8. Phone restarts automatically

The lock screen is removed after flashing.

How to Flash Xiaomi Phone After Forgot Pattern or PIN Lock

Xiaomi devices use fastboot flashing.

Tools Required

  • Mi Flash Tool
  • Xiaomi USB drivers
  • Fastboot firmware

Xiaomi Flashing Steps

  1. Turn off phone
  2. Press Volume Down + Power
  3. Enter Fastboot Mode
  4. Connect phone to PC
  5. Open Mi Flash Tool
  6. Select firmware folder
  7. Choose “Clean All”
  8. Click Flash
  9. Wait until complete

This removes the lock but also erases data.

How to Flash Oppo, Vivo, Realme Phone After Forgot Lock

These brands use different flash tools depending on chipset.

Common Tools Used

  • SP Flash Tool (MediaTek)
  • QFIL Tool (Qualcomm)

Basic Flashing Process

  1. Install USB drivers
  2. Download correct firmware
  3. Open flash tool
  4. Load scatter or programmer file
  5. Power off phone
  6. Connect phone to PC
  7. Start flashing
  8. Wait until success message

Phone restarts without lock.

FRP Lock After Flashing: What Beginners Must Know

FRP (Factory Reset Protection) is Google’s security feature.

Why FRP Appears After Flashing

  • Phone was previously linked to Google account
  • Flashing resets system
  • Google asks for previous credentials

Important FRP Rules

  • Flashing does not legally remove FRP
  • Original Google account is required
  • Bypass methods vary by Android version
  • Unauthorized bypass may violate policies

Always use your own device and account.

Common Mistakes Beginners Make While Flashing Android

Avoid these mistakes:

  • Flashing wrong firmware
  • Interrupting flashing process
  • Using incompatible flash tool
  • Low battery during flashing
  • Ignoring chipset type
  • Not installing drivers properly

One mistake can permanently brick the phone.
